Many years ago, I stayed in a B&B in Edinburgh. The patriarch of the host family liked to have breakfast with the guests. Somehow the conversation came around to Liz. (Quite possibly a frequent occurrence in that house.) "Ayyyyye. The second of *England*. But the fust of Sco'land!!" The sheer contempt in his voice. This goes all the way back to James I. (I know the general enmity goes back further than that.)

Diff. with Ireland is that the conflict is still in the living memory.

Echoes of ill-feeling toward the retreating empire linger all over the world, even in its own backyard. It's only to be expected that this moment has roused them to new life.

On a related note. Respect for "the monarchy" is constantly conflated with respect for the persona of Elizabeth II. For many people they are one and the same. We see this in the pro-monarchy movement here in Oz: "but the Queen is such a stalwart lady who commands the highest respect. You want to get rid of HER?" It's a different ball game now, and people are going to see that there is the institution of monarchy, and then there's the sitting monarch, whom you may not like. Two different things and the latter may lead to a re-appraisal of the former.

That's why we have seen the pro-republic movement more or less sit on its hands for the last 20-odd years. It's an unwinnable debate as long as the Queen reigned.
